-During the Music Man, our percussionist who was trapped in a corner of the pit behind his timpanis falling ill during a show and having to climb over the entire orchestra to get out in the middle of a song (and still managing to get out before he threw up!)
-During the riot scene at the end of the first act of fiddler on the roof, a glass falling off the stage, hitting a timp and making a fantastic noise.
-Splurge guns going all over the place in Bugsy Malone
And one i've always wanted to do, and just might this year for Seussical...
Ever noticed how many shows have designated spots for the orchestra to tune, warm up etc at the start of an act or piece? Ive never had the nerve to get half the band to play an a and the other half to play a Bb but ive always wanted to....
